I guess it's time for me to reply. I've had the bike 6 days now and although it's been hot and slow going I've somehow managed 1,318 miles since I picked it up from Nashcat. :biggrin: :cool::wine2::rofl1:

I would say I like riding it just fine. I got my ol Garmin car type GPS mounted in the GPS dash pocket and I switched seats to a better seat. I managed a 302 mile run today with only one stop light stop in the run. It took 6.00 gallons of gas, I was using midgrade 89 ocrtane gas which made 50.333 MPG at an almost constant 70 MPH from my fill up in Old Town FL. to Pensacola. I think I got around 43-44 running 80 from Nashcat's to home last Sunday so good mpg I'd say.
